John BEST and wife Catherine MILLER settled in Washington
County, Pennsylvania in the 1700's. The land patented by
John Best was he called "Bestbury" and it was on Buffalo
Creek.
John BEST died 1795 and Catherine MILLER about 1814.
This couple had seven children:
1. Nancy BEST
d. about 1813
m. John CASEBEER
This family moved to Tuscaraws Co., Ohio
They had 11 children: Elizabeth, John Jr., David,
Pleasant, Mary, Anna, Andrew S., Catherine, Adam,
Jacob, and Hannah. (I can trace from John Jr. down
to my Grandmother, Jenne Lind Casebeer)
2. John BEST, Jr.
m. Christania
Children unknown
3. Samuel BEST
d. 5/25/1816 Tuscarawas County, Ohio
m. Agnes Casebeer, sister of John CASEBEER, above.
They had 5 children (mentioned in Samuel's will): Sally,
Absolem, Zacharias, Henry, and Nancy.
4. Adam BEST
m. Sarah McMULLIN
Children unknown
5. Mary C. BEST
m. Henry SMITH
Children unknown
6. Elizabeth BEST
m. Barnett JOHNSON
Children unknown
7. Pleasant BEST
m. Peter WEAVER
Children unknown
I have a copy of Samuel BEST's will, as well a copy of
some typewritten pages (about 40) entitled BEST FAMILY
GENEALOGY 1795-1941. The book is really more anecdotes of
the BEST family followed by a tracking of thier land,
BESTBURY, down through the years as it changed hands.
